Ashton Kutcher's less-than-memorable "Butterfly Effect" examines (with time travel, natch) the common chaos theory example that if a butterfly flaps its wings in the Amazon, a convoluted chain of events causes a rainstorm in, say, Paris. The Guardian takes a look at the butterfly effect in reverse: if a kid in England buys some Chicken McNuggets, how many acres of Amazon land does agri-business giant Cargill destroy?
